0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

如何判断单片机是否起振?如何判断晶振的好坏?

工程师邓生 来源:未知 作者:刘芹 2024-01-16 11:20 次阅读

如何判断单片机是否起振?如何判断晶振的好坏?

判断单片机是否起振以及晶振的好坏是单片机开发和相关领域中常见的问题。

首先,我们需要了解什么是单片机起振以及晶振的作用。在单片机系统中,晶振是提供时钟信号的重要组成部分。单片机需要时钟信号来同步其各个部件的工作。如果单片机无法起振,将无法正常工作。因此,判断单片机是否起振以及晶振的好坏对于单片机开发和调试是非常重要的。

一、如何判断单片机是否起振

判断单片机是否起振的方法有多种,下面是几种常用的方法:

1. 使用示波器观察晶振输出波形:示波器是一种常用的测试仪器,可以用来观察信号的波形。当单片机正常起振时,晶振输出的波形应该是一个稳定的方波信号。如果波形不稳定或者没有信号输出,那么单片机可能没有起振。

2. 使用LED指示灯判断:有些开发板或者单片机模块上会设计有一个用来指示晶振工作状态的LED灯。当单片机起振时,LED灯会闪烁或者保持亮灭。如果LED没有亮起,那么单片机可能没有起振。

3. 使用串口通信进行检测:可以通过串口通信判断单片机是否起振。首先,在程序中编写一个简单的串口输出函数,然后在程序开始的时候调用该函数输出一个固定的字符。如果串口正常工作,那么在电脑上连接单片机的串口观察输出结果,如果正常输出了字符,说明单片机已经起振。

4. 使用复位信号检测:复位信号是单片机的一种控制信号,当复位信号为高电平时,单片机会进入复位状态,当复位信号变为低电平时,单片机会正常工作。我们可以通过检测复位信号的变化来判断单片机是否起振。如果复位信号一直保持高电平而没有下降,那么单片机可能没有起振。

以上是判断单片机是否起振的几种常见方法,可以根据实际情况选择适合的方法进行判断。但需要注意的是,这些方法只能初步判断单片机是否有起振信号,并不能完全确定单片机是否正常工作。如果发现单片机没有起振,需要进一步检查电源供电、晶体振荡电路等。

二、如何判断晶振的好坏

晶振作为单片机系统的重要组成部分,其质量好坏直接影响到单片机工作的稳定性和性能。下面是几种常见的判断晶振好坏的方法:

1. 观察晶振输出波形:使用示波器观察晶振输出的波形,如果波形稳定、频率准确,并且没有明显的幅度变化或者波形畸变,那么说明晶振质量较好。

2. 测量晶振输出频率:使用频率计或者示波器等仪器测量晶振输出的频率。如果测量结果与晶振标称频率相差不大,那么说明晶振质量较好。

3. 检查晶振电压:通过检查晶振电压来判断晶振的好坏。一般来说,晶振电压应在标称电压范围内,并且电压波动较小。如果晶振电压超出标称电压范围或者波动较大,那么说明晶振可能存在问题。

4. 切换到其他晶振进行测试:如果怀疑当前使用的晶振存在问题,可以尝试使用其他的晶振进行测试。如果切换到其他晶振后,单片机能够正常起振,那么说明原来的晶振可能存在问题。

需要注意的是,以上的方法只能初步判断晶振的好坏,并不能百分之百确定晶振的质量。如果怀疑晶振存在问题,可以选择更高精度的仪器或者咨询专业人士进行检测。

总结起来,判断单片机是否起振以及晶振的好坏是单片机开发中非常重要的工作。可以通过使用示波器观察波形、LED指示灯、串口通信等方法来判断单片机是否起振;可以通过观察波形、测量频率、检查电压等方法来判断晶振的好坏。但需要注意的是,以上方法只能初步判断,并不能完全确定单片机是否正常起振以及晶振的质量,如果怀疑存在问题,应该进一步检查和测试。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 单片机
    +关注

    关注

    6001

    文章

    43973

    浏览量

    620847
  • 晶振
    +关注

    关注

    32

    文章

    2473

    浏览量

    66850
收藏 人收藏

    评论

    相关推荐

    外部高速或者外部低俗是什么原因引起的?

    经常会碰到外部高速或者外部低俗问题,不知道怎么系统地学习
    发表于 03-26 07:44

    STM32F407VGT6低速采用外置的无源32.768kHz,出现了大量的不怎么解决?

    最近公司买进了一批新的马来西亚生产的STM32F407VGT6单片机,低速采用外置的无源32.768kHz,出现了大量的不
    发表于 03-18 06:36

    怎么判断是否该怎么办?

    欧姆。 **·**目视检查:仔细观察引脚与电路板之间的焊接情况,确保引脚焊接牢固,没有冷焊、断裂或错位。 2. 确认负载电容和负载电阻 **·**查阅规格书:根据所使用的单片机或芯片的规格书,确保
    发表于 03-06 17:22

    如何判断有源的工作电压?从的表面能看的出来吗?

    如何判断有源的工作电压?从的表面能看的出来吗? 求高手帮忙
    发表于 01-09 06:00

    ADAS1000的原因?

    现有一个问题想请教一下,我使用ADAS1000-3搭配STM32进行单导心电电路的搭建,对ADAS1000进行初始化后用示波器测ADAS1000的外部没有信号,即没有。请看一下
    发表于 12-19 06:12

    AD7768用无源的时候无法是为什么?

    我在使用AD7768的过程中,clk_sel拉高,使用外部或者LVDS,使用LVDS的时候采样正常,但是用无源的时候
    发表于 12-11 08:22

    proteus仿真avr单片机怎么设置频率?

    proteus仿真avr单片机怎么设置频率?
    发表于 11-08 07:28

    51单片机电路原理是什么?

    51 单片机电路原理是什么?
    发表于 10-31 07:39

    单片机频率怎么选择?

    单片机频率怎么选择,同样是51系列,走的是11.0592mhz,有的用mhz
    发表于 10-25 06:40

    单片机GND连接后5V直流电压不的原因?

    单片机GND连接后,5V直流电压不,原因可能是?
    发表于 10-18 07:13

    stc52单片机是为什么?

    stc52单片机两端电压只有0.1V
    发表于 09-26 07:52

    单片机通电是为什么?

    单片机通电,16MHz的,两个震荡电容为22pF。
    发表于 09-25 08:07

    STM32F407VGT6低速的问题,请问低速电路需要注意哪些点呢?

    最近公司买进了一批新的马来西亚生产的STM32F407VGT6单片机,低速采用外置的无源32.768kHz,出现了大量的不
    发表于 08-07 08:52

    怎么判断单片机是否起振 如何判断晶振好坏

    该怎么判断单片机是否起振?如何判断晶振好坏
    发表于 07-21 09:15 1133次阅读
    怎么<b class='flag-5'>判断</b><b class='flag-5'>单片机</b><b class='flag-5'>是否</b>起振 如何<b class='flag-5'>判断</b>晶振<b class='flag-5'>好坏</b>

    请问新唐单片机在外部失灵的情况下,能否自动切换到内部继续工作?

    请问新唐单片机在外部失灵的情况下,能否自动切换到内部继续工作?
    发表于 06-16 07:27